Function Group: F11E
Program Name: SAPLF11E
Main Program: SAPLF11E
Appliation area: F
Release date: N/A
Mode(Normal, Remote etc): Normal Function Module

Function FI_PAYMENT_RUN_ENQUEUE pattern details
In-order to call this FM within your sap programs, simply using the below ABAP pattern details to trigger the function call...or see the full ABAP code listing at the end of this article. You can simply cut and paste this code into your ABAP progrom as it is, including variable declarations.CALL FUNCTION 'FI_PAYMENT_RUN_ENQUEUE'".
EXPORTING
I_LAUFI = "Identification of payment parameters
I_LAUFD = "Date of payment parameters
IMPORTING
E_ERROR = "Error Key
IMPORTING Parameters details for FI_PAYMENT_RUN_ENQUEUE
I_LAUFI - Identification of payment parameters
Data type: T042X-LAUFIOptional: No
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)
I_LAUFD - Date of payment parameters
Data type: T042X-LAUFDOptional: No
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)
EXPORTING Parameters details for FI_PAYMENT_RUN_ENQUEUE
E_ERROR - Error Key
Data type: SY-SUBRCOptional: No
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)
